To safely execute a plunge cut with a circular saw, follow these steps:
- Mark the cut line on the material.
- Adjust the saw blade depth to slightly deeper than the material thickness.
- Hold the saw firmly with both hands and position it at the edge of the material.
- Start the saw and slowly lower the blade into the material at the marked cut line.
- Keep a steady hand and move the saw along the cut line smoothly.
- Once the cut is complete, release the trigger and wait for the blade to stop before lifting the saw.
